Output d7d2154de87a46c5b8411c22f73ab89c5cba0cd58759db388b1b1f256cce0d26:0
- value
- 43000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18ef76f7e2669d72e985588ead0af49778ae87aa OP_EQUAL
- address
- 33xs1Swhoc3pHdNPxPC8epu3vZjxFx7FiE
- transaction
- d7d2154de87a46c5b8411c22f73ab89c5cba0cd58759db388b1b1f256cce0d26
- confirmations
- 367168
- spent
- true